Output 99ab73b1c5d909960d55800f93a4e03b3f491d640f41639077544d614d117a07:0

value
664085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31beb1c3b54be3d9d77d55641be23d0c0f0cdb5c OP_EQUAL
address
36E3Ud34ZjuaFWCzVwmfQLiKWDcE2gH1Dh
transaction
99ab73b1c5d909960d55800f93a4e03b3f491d640f41639077544d614d117a07